As a System Engineer, you will have an exciting opportunity to make a tangible difference to the UK\’s Armed Forces, and will give you the chance to grow your skills and knowledge in an area of Systems Engineering that deals with some the latest technologies being utilised by the Royal Navy. Some tips for your application 🫡

Understand the Role: Read the job description thoroughly to grasp the responsibilities and requirements of a Maritime Systems Engineer. This will help you tailor your application to highlight relevant skills and experiences.

Highlight Relevant Experience: In your CV and cover letter, focus on any previous experience related to systems engineering or maritime technologies. Use specific examples to demonstrate your expertise and how it aligns with the role.

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that not only outlines your qualifications but also expresses your enthusiasm for contributing to the UK’s Armed Forces. Mention why you are particularly interested in this position and how you can make a difference.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ects attention to detail, which is crucial in engineering roles.
